summaryrefslogtreecommitdiff
path: root/nonprism/pidgin
diff options
context:
space:
mode:
Diffstat (limited to 'nonprism/pidgin')
-rw-r--r--nonprism/pidgin/PKGBUILD30
1 files changed, 13 insertions, 17 deletions
diff --git a/nonprism/pidgin/PKGBUILD b/nonprism/pidgin/PKGBUILD
index 8bd8211ae..a848861ef 100644
--- a/nonprism/pidgin/PKGBUILD
+++ b/nonprism/pidgin/PKGBUILD
@@ -1,4 +1,4 @@
-# $Id: PKGBUILD 248318 2015-10-03 23:12:21Z foutrelis $
+# $Id: PKGBUILD 248703 2015-10-09 18:10:52Z foutrelis $
# Maintainer (Arch): Evangelos Foutras <evangelos@foutrelis.com>
# Contributor (Arch): Ionut Biru <ibiru@archlinux.org>
# Contributor (Arch): Andrea Scarpino <andrea@archlinux.org>
@@ -7,28 +7,24 @@
# Maintainer: André Silva <emulatorman@parabola.nu>
# Contributor: Márcio Silva <coadde@parabola.nu>
-pkgname=pidgin
pkgname=('pidgin' 'libpurple' 'finch')
pkgver=2.10.11
-pkgrel=4.nonprism1
+pkgrel=5.nonprism1
+_rev=cbc4db14444c91f4f4b03aa1b228c2d51dacea6b
arch=('i686' 'x86_64')
url="http://pidgin.im/"
license=('GPL')
makedepends=('startup-notification' 'gtkspell' 'libxss' 'nss' 'libsasl' 'libsm'
'libidn' 'python2' 'hicolor-icon-theme' 'farstream'
- 'avahi' 'tk' 'ca-certificates' 'intltool' 'networkmanager')
-source=(https://downloads.sourceforge.net/project/$pkgname/Pidgin/$pkgver/$pkgname-$pkgver.tar.bz2
- pidgin-2.10.11-gstreamer1.patch
+ 'avahi' 'tk' 'ca-certificates' 'intltool' 'networkmanager'
+ 'mercurial')
+source=(pidgin::hg+https://bitbucket.org/pidgin/main#revision=$_rev
nonprism.patch)
-sha256sums=('f2ae211341fc77efb9945d40e9932aa535cdf3a6c8993fe7919fca8cc1c04007'
- '0b083115c4cc05e6da1d1e66fd1b9c33167417a43c12d932f664e6d87dc0afbe'
+sha256sums=('SKIP'
'f720dc9aca3191b65cd89828ab7266e06d93203b7f0de9ac6b506227b00b0bc0')
prepare() {
- cd "$srcdir/$pkgname-$pkgver"
-
- # Backport support for GStreamer 1.0
- patch -Np1 -i ../pidgin-2.10.11-gstreamer1.patch
+ cd $pkgbase
msg "Remove Google Talk and Facebook protocols"
patch -Np1 -i "$srcdir/nonprism.patch"
@@ -45,9 +41,9 @@ prepare() {
}
build() {
- cd "$srcdir/$pkgname-$pkgver"
+ cd $pkgbase
- ./configure \
+ ./autogen.sh \
--prefix=/usr \
--sysconfdir=/etc \
--disable-schemas-install \
@@ -71,7 +67,7 @@ package_pidgin(){
replaces=(${pkgname}-nonprism)
install=pidgin.install
- cd "$srcdir/pidgin-$pkgver"
+ cd $pkgbase
# For linking
make -C libpurple DESTDIR="$pkgdir" install-libLTLIBRARIES
@@ -107,7 +103,7 @@ package_libpurple(){
conflicts=(${pkgname}-nonprism)
replaces=(${pkgname}-nonprism)
- cd "$srcdir/pidgin-$pkgver"
+ cd $pkgbase
for _dir in libpurple share/sounds share/ca-certs m4macros po; do
make -C "$_dir" DESTDIR="$pkgdir" install
@@ -120,7 +116,7 @@ package_finch(){
conflicts=(${pkgname}-nonprism)
replaces=(${pkgname}-nonprism)
- cd "$srcdir/pidgin-$pkgver"
+ cd $pkgbase
# For linking
make -C libpurple DESTDIR="$pkgdir" install-libLTLIBRARIES